Can you tie the serial numbers to the property numbers. I would like to use the information in my research of R-Marine and K-Marine Navy Lugers. I recently found a rather nice and scarce K-Marine Luger. It is a 1939-S/42 number 5382n with a North Sea property number of N3596.

29 DWM Navy S/N 8377s, Navy property MA O.1292. with 1920 reichswehr chamber date.
All matching except the firing pin. And I don't know about the mag, a matching number but I think a field armorer match.

Don, I hope/ think this is what you want. If not please don't hesitate to ask. I'll send photo's of whatever you'd like. I would be proud to have it included in your research.

I just happened upon it on dumb luck. From my research I'm finding they are somewhat scarce.
